Which of the following is correct concerning financial statements in annual reports (Form 10-K) and quarterly reports (Form 10-Q)?




a. Both Form 10-K and Form 10-Q must be audited by independent public accountants and both must be filed with the SEC.
b. Both Form 10-K and Form 10-Q must be audited by independent public accountants but neither need be filed with the SEC.
c. Although both Form 10-K and Form 10-Q must be filed with the SEC, only Form 10-K need be audited by independent public accountants.
d. Form 10-K must be audited by independent public accountants and must also be filed with the SEC; however, Form 10-Q need not be audited by independent public accountants nor filed with the SEC.





Answer: C
